Born to slave-holding aristocracy in Richmond, Virginia, and educated by northern Quakers, Elizabeth Van Lew was a paradox of her time. When Virginia seceded, Van Lew's convictions compelled her to defy the new Confederate regime. Pledging her loyalty to the Union, her courage in clandestine combat would never waver, even as her actions threatened her reputation and her life. Van Lew's skills in gathering military intelligence were unparalleled in ingenuity. Although celebrated by Northern leaders and posthumously inducted into the Military Intelligence Hall of Fame, the astonishing scope of Elizabeth Van Lew's achievements has never been widely known until now.
